Mauritius, with its humid tropical climate and high salinity air, presents a unique challenge for kitchenware durability. Traditional plastics often degrade or leach chemicals under high temperatures, leading to a surge in demand for glass food storage container options that are non-reactive and easy to sterilize.
The island's thriving tourism sector and luxury resort industry require equipment that balances aesthetic elegance with industrial strength. This has created a niche for high-end glass mixing bowl set collections that can transition seamlessly from a professional prep station to a guest-facing table.
Moreover, the growing urban middle class in Port Louis and surrounding areas is shifting toward healthier lifestyle choices, increasing the penetration of microwavable glass containers for meal prepping and reducing reliance on disposable packaging.
